Hiryuusan has been watching a run of black bear reports around Mitsumine Shrine and Otaki, Chichibu City, and the sharpest recent alarm came on March 12, 2026 at 23:50, when a bear about 1.5 meters long was reported near the shrine and again near the Takizawa Dam management office. Another sighting followed in Otaki, Chichibu City on March 16, 2026, with a bear about 1.5 meters tall reported there as well.
The busiest ground has been around Chichibu Mitsumine and Otaki, Chichibu, with activity also turning up in Chichibu 麻生. Reports peaked in October 2025 with 12 incidents and stayed high in November 2025 with 11, while March 2026 and January 2026 each showed 4 incidents; this area has now recorded 145 black bear sightings overall.

What type of bears are in Hiryuusan?
Hiryuusan is home to Asian black bears, which weigh up to 120kg and inhabit the mountains of Honshu and Shikoku. They are generally shy but can be dangerous when surprised or protecting cubs. Carry bear bells while hiking.
